Operation: How to reset the TPMS on the Kia Stonic.

If we notice the low tire pressure warning light on this car model, the first thing we need to do is check the actual tire pressure and make sure there is no puncture. Then proceed to restore the correct pressure as specified by the manufacturer. The instructions on how to reset the warning light are provided in the following text. After sitting in the driver's seat, turn on the ignition and locate the TPMS reset button on the left side of the dashboard near the door. Press this button and the warning light on the dashboard will turn off.

How do you replace the battery of the BMW R 1250 GS?

In order to replace the battery of the BMW R 1250 GS it is necessary to loosen the bolts that secure the casing positioned on the left side of the bike, so that its cover can be removed. Once this has been removed, you will be able to access the components below, including the battery. The latter must be removed from its housing by disconnecting the power cables and unscrewing the appropriate fixing bolts. In this way it will be possible to insert a new battery, properly fixing it and connecting it to the relative cables, covering everything with the casing.
